Abstract

The aim of this study was to evaluate the early detection of antibodies by the microscopic agglutination test (MAT) using saprophytic leptospira serovar Patoc (MAT-Patoc), in serum samples from patients with confirmed leptospirosis. The obtained results were compared with those found in ELISA-IgM. A hundred fifty-eight serum samples collected from patients in acute phase of illness were analysed by MAT-Patoc. Samples with titers ≥ 50 were considered positive. The sensitivity of MAT-Patoc and IgM-ELISA was 13.29 % and 28.48 %, respectively. In the first seven days of the disease, MAT-Patoc was positive in 12.29 % of the cases, while the IgM-ELISA was positive in 24.59 %. The MAT-Patoc was positive in sera from confirmed cases, and the infecting serogroups were Icterohaemorrhagiae, Cynopteri and Ballum. In conclusion, the use of MAT-Patoc test showed lower sensitivity for diagnosing leptospirosis when compared with ELISA-IgM, although positive reactivity was found in some samples with negative results. The MAT-Patoc should be used in combination with ELISA-IgM to improve the sensitivity of the diagnosis of leptospirosis in the first phase of the disease, with subsequent confirmation by standard MAT.
